Knox Fertilizer Company 16-0-8 Fertilizer

16-0-8 Fertilizer is for professional use, apply throughout the growing season on cool, warm and transitional grasses. This product is ideal for low volume spraying. Dilute with water according to desired nitrogen rate, typically 0.25-0.75 lb nitrogen per 1,000 sq. ft. In the absence of specific nitrogen recommendation, apply 18-53 fl. oz. product per 1000 sq. ft.

Guaranteed Analysis
Total Nitrogen (N) - 16%
16% Urea Nitrogen
Available Potash (K2O) - 8%
Iron (Fe) - 0.1%
1.0 % Chelated Iron (Fe)
Manganese (Mn) - 0.05%
0.05% Chelated Manganese (Mn)
Chlorine (Cl) not more than - 8%
Derived from Urea, Potassium Chloride, urea, Iron EDTA Chelate and Manganese EDTA Chelate.

Storage & Handling

Mixing and Handling Instructions

Fill spray tank with half of required water volume and begin agitation. Add products in this order, mixing thoroughly after each addition: adjuvants, pesticides, then fertilizers. Fill tank with remainder of water and continue agitation until spray solution is completely mixed. Check chemical mixture compatibility using a jar test prior to application.Do not apply near water, storm drains, or drainage ditches. Do not apply if heavy rains are expected.
